System roles
Student
Students use My Progress to reflect on their progress, record goals, review their skills and attributes, and engage with support offered through Academic Advising. The system supports students in taking an active role in their academic progress, personal development and future planning. Find out more about the guidance available to students on the Academic Skills Kit website.
Academic Adviser
Academic Advisers use My Progress to support conversations with students about their progress, development and goals. The system provides access to relevant student information, reflections, goals and engagement data, helping advisers provide personalised, structured and evidence-informed support.
Director of Academic Advising
Directors of Academic Advising use My Progress to support oversight of Academic Advising within their Academic Unit. The system provides visibility of advising activity, student engagement and adviser allocation, helping to inform evaluation and support consistent practice across the Unit.
Wellbeing
Wellbeing colleagues use My Progress to support students and facilitate coordinated support across the University. Access is tailored to the needs of the role and helps colleagues understand relevant student information, engage with students where appropriate, and work effectively with other support services.
Support to Study
The Support to Study role allows colleagues to use My Progress to record and manage Level 2 Support to Study meetings with students across their School.
PS Admin
This role is for Professional Services colleagues who support their School’s administration of the system.
